JOB TITLE: Billing Coordinator
OVERVIEW: Duane Morris LLP, a global law firm with 900 attorneys in offices across the U.S. and around the world, offers innovative solutions to the legal and business challenges presented by today’s evolving global markets.
SUMMARY: Provides billing coordination for a Billing Partner within the firm.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Audit, edit, and prepare paper and e-billing files in a timely manner for Billing Partner
- Create and prepare intricate invoice layouts reflecting the fixed fees/flat fees negotiated, payments received and applicable write-offs applied.
- Identify time entries and costs that may be on an incorrect matter for Manager review.
- Pull expense backup from several different firm systems to include with the invoice to the client/insurance company.
- Manage the execution of the e-billing process.
- Analyze e-billing errors and resolve for re-submission.
- Execute client and insurance e-billing/billing guidelines for compliance with time entries and billing processes.
- Review of several thousand time entries on every matter to ensure compliance with client and insurance requirements
- Apply unallocated payments to invoices at directed by the Manager.
- Execute the terms expressed in the client engagement letters accordingly.
- Creation of intricate erosion charts for insured clients
- Prepare reports for Billing Partner containing MTD billing, collection, aged and WIP totals.
- Code client/matters according to e-billing/billing guideline requirements.
- Submit accruals, appeals, budgets, rates and status requests using firm ebilling vendor software for e-billed clients.
- Analyze timekeeper rates for accuracy.
- Communicate with timekeepers regarding missing client required details in their time entry narratives.
- Maintain correct address and contact information for invoices in the billing system.
